Property Overview
30 Trefoil Drive is within a 150-acre business park that provides abundant parking for employees or clients, dedicated on-site management, and tenant signage in front of the building.
The building has been fitted out by one of the largest consumer products companies in the world for research and testing of their products, that these products continue to meet the highest standards for delivery to consumers.
The property has outdoor picnic area for employees which overlooks a scenic pond and fountain. 30 Trefoil Drive is easily reachable from a majority of the area’s major highways; less than 1-mile to the Route 25 connector and 5.5 miles to the Merritt Parkway (Route 15). New Haven is 30 minutes, and Manhattan is approximately an hour and twenty minutes from 30 Trefoil Drive. 30 Trefoil Drive is 10 miles from the Bridgeport Amtrak train station.
Nearby are several local amenities that will add to the quality of work and quality of life for employees, including excellent schools, easily accessible golf, tennis, and water sports. A Bright Horizons Daycare Center is within walking distance and is included in the buildings owned and managed by the Landlord. There are a number of other amenities within minutes, on Monroe Turnpike: Edge Fitness Club, The Home Depot, Walgreens, Chip’s Restaurant, Prime One Eleven Restaurant, a United States Post Office, and more.
The Town of Trumbull is exceptionally business-friendly, with a lower cost of doing business than surrounding locales. The town offers a high quality of life, boasting the most open space per capita in the state. These factors allow Trumbull to attract a high percentage of college graduates and professional talent specializing in IT, sciences, engineering, management, and executive roles. 30 Trefoil Drive allows businesses to take advantage of all that the Town of Trumbull in Fairfield County has to offer.

About Trumbull
Trumbull is in Fairfield County, the southern-most county in Connecticut, one of 23 municipalities in this wealthiest of Connecticut counties.
Trumbull has 21 parks totaling more acreage than New York City’s Central Park. It has access to 74 biking / hiking / running trails, covering 551 miles. At the end of Corporate Drive, there is access to Old Mine Park. Trumbull is home to Tashua Knolls Golf Course, a public golf course, which has 27 holes – an 18-hole course and a par 3, Executive course. The course is one to two miles from Trefoil Park Properties five buildings. Trumbull is among the top 10% of school districts in Connecticut.
The town of Trumbull is a vibrant community that combines small-town New England character and charm with extensive retail, commercial, and light manufacturing activity.
Office properties in this area are located in more of a suburban setting, with buildings located in close proximity to major retailers, schools, and parks. A wooded setting coupled with a lower cost of doing business continues to drive occupiers to Trumbull.
Commercial properties here are easily accessible via a variety of routes such as Merritt Parkway, I-95, Route 8, Route 25, and the Monroe Turnpike. These access points have drawn the interest of major retailers such as Home Depot, Walmart, and the Westfield Trumbull shopping mall.
Trumbull remains an attractive area to score talent as a significant portion of the population here has obtained a four-year college degree, with a notable percentage of college graduates in STEM fields.
